The River Front Cafe in Needles, CA, offers a charming dining experience along the riverfront. With a cozy atmosphere and delicious menu options, it is a popular spot for locals and visitors alike.
Guests can enjoy a variety of dishes while taking in scenic views of the river. The cafe provides a relaxing setting for a meal or a casual hangout with friends and family.
Generated from the website